#d03d14 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d03d14 is composed of 81.6% red, 23.9%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.7% magenta, 90.4%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 13.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 44.7%. #d03d14 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7a28 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d03d14 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d03d14 has RGB values of R:208, G:61,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.9,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13647124.

Shades and Tints of #d03d14
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0301 is the darkest color, while #fefa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d03d14
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#786e6c is the less saturated color, while #e23302 is the most saturated one.
